>   The latest change (adding DEPENDS) made expect build and install
>   tcl/tk even if they are properly found by LIB_DEPENDS.  Make it
>   only extract in that case.

Thanks - if you haven't already, I'll update tk4 to do the same thing.

I knew that this was a quick-and-dirty way of doing it, but the
previous version of the port was broken (as was tk4) in that if the
sources it depended upon weren't *extracted*, not so much built, it
would fall over due to dependencies on header files and such that are
internal to the TCL port.

>   While I'm here, make expect and expectk link with shared tcl/tk libs.
>   expectk used to be a 1/2 MB binary!  (now it's 136KB)
